Transaction 345519193503018671529a17f1837f92761c4236a1cf7b98dfc26838fa515d87

2 Input
2 Outputs
  • 345519193503018671529a17f1837f92761c4236a1cf7b98dfc26838fa515d87:0
  • value  3446998
    address  17dDp3UfXHr6B8sEnJW2XmHTe7UtuDqaFP
  • 345519193503018671529a17f1837f92761c4236a1cf7b98dfc26838fa515d87:1
  • value  1237707
    address  bc1q2qt3s847kt063mzyzfcwyntaj0347ys3g4n65t